Description

Envelope sent to the Commissioner of Patents, Washington, D.C. postmarked Newark, August 10, 1923 from Edward C. Worden, Analytical and Consulting Chemist, Millburn New Jersey. Edward Chauncey Worden was a renowned chemist, who held 8 patents, issued between 1931-1934, for his work on cellulose manufacturing. He became the head of Worden Laboratory, located at his house at 118 Sagamore norad, and went on to use his expertise to develop airplane wing coatings, which were used extensively by the US Military in WWI.
